SECURITY ACCESS CONTROL ENGINE - HOW & WHY

The OpenLDAP Accelerator is a Policy Decision Point that resides inside the slapd process. This presentation - “Introducing a Security Access Control Engine” – explains how it works and why it’s important. We’ll explore ideas of protocol standardization to promote interoperability across directory implementations. At the end is a demo to illustrate the value proposition of this unique design.
